6.2.9 Intrusion Severities

Use this report to look at the severity (significance) of intrusions by number of intrusions. The
levels of severity, in decreasing order of significance, are Emergency (system is unusable),
Alert (immediate action is required), Critical, Error, Warning, Notice, Informational, and
Debug.
Note: To look at intrusion reports, each ZyXEL device must record intrusions in its
log. See the User's Guide for each ZyXEL device for more information. In most
devices, go to Logs > Log Settings, and make sure IDP is enabled. Then, go
to IDP > Signature, and make sure the ZyXEL device logs each Attack Type
you want to see in Vantage Report.
Click Network Attack > Intrusion > By Severity to open this screen.
